Why does my cable not have sound?
Make sure that your cable wires aren’t damaged and are securely connected. Make sure the TV and/or additional equipment is set to the same channel (3 or 4). Try changing the channel. If no other channels have the same issue, then it might be an issue with just the one channel.
How do you mute the sound on Zoom?
Disabling audio by default
- Sign in to the Zoom Desktop Client.
- Click your profile picture then click Settings.
- Click Audio .
- Select the Mute my microphone when joining a meeting check box.
What happens when you use speaker wire instead of cable?
Using non-standard wire or cables instead of speaker wire can result in sound changes, although very minor. Excessively long or other high-resistance wire can affect the sound by causing a drop in speaker volume.

How can I fix no sound on my TV?
Television Has No Sound Answer 8: If using an “S” video cable into an input on the back of your TV, these cables carry no sound, just video, so make sure you connect an audio cable too. Television Has No Sound Answer 9: Hook up an external device to the “TV audio out” input.
